Smoky Mushroom & Artichoke Paella

Smoky mushroom and artichoke paella with peppers, green beans and peas in a black paella pan.

Deeply browned mushrooms and tender artichoke hearts make this plant-based paella every bit as satisfying as the meatier versions. The hickory, paprika and tomato in Paella Spice reinforce the vegetables’ savoury character.

🥣 Ingredients

  • 300g paella rice
  • 400g mixed mushrooms, roughly sliced
  • 240g jar artichoke hearts, drained and quartered
  • 1 red pepper, sliced
  • 100g green beans, halved
  • 100g frozen peas
  • 1 onion, finely chopped
  • 2 tbsp Paella Spice
  • 3 tbsp olive oil
  • 400g tin chopped tomatoes
  • 800ml hot vegetable stock
  • 1 lemon
  • Sea salt, to taste

👩‍🍳 Instructions

  1. Heat 1 tbsp oil in a wide pan over high heat. Brown the mushrooms in two batches, then set aside.
  2. Reduce the heat, add remaining oil and cook onion and pepper for 6 minutes. Stir in the Paella Spice.
  3. Add rice, tomatoes and stock. Simmer uncovered for 18–22 minutes without frequent stirring.
  4. Add green beans after 10 minutes. Return mushrooms with the artichokes and peas for the final 5 minutes.
  5. Rest for 5 minutes, season to taste and serve with lemon.

⏱️ Timings

  • Prep: 15 minutes
  • Cook: 35 minutes
  • Serves: 4–6

🍽️ Serving Suggestions

Bring the whole pan to the table with dressed leaves and crusty bread.

💚 Why This Recipe Works

Browning mushrooms separately prevents them becoming watery and gives the finished rice a deeper savoury flavour.
